What We Covered

Restoration and healing are possible — often through natural approaches that address the whole person. Here's the ground we walked through together.

1

Your Neurotransmitters

What "chemical imbalance" actually means, and how serotonin and dopamine are built — including the surprising role your gut plays in producing both.

2

Your Nutrient Intake

The specific building blocks your brain needs to make its own "happiness" chemicals, and how genetic factors like MTHFR change what your body can use.

3

Toxins & Inflammation

Everyday sources of toxic load, why they matter for mood, and what "pure and sufficient" looks like in daily life.

4

Your Gut Health

Why gut healing is central to mood, what damages it (including antibiotics), and practical steps — prebiotics, probiotics, polyphenols — to restore it.

5

Stress, Adrenals & Fitness

How adrenal fatigue develops, what supports recovery, and why movement, sleep, and nervous-system care all belong in the same conversation.

6

Emotional & Spiritual Needs

Addressing the whole person — including the emotional and spiritual roots that so often sit underneath anxiety and depression.
